  • Introducing the new Soldano Astro 20, the latest creation from the legendary Mike Soldano, mastermind behind the iconic SLO series. Bridging the gap between traditional valve amps and new digital amp technology, the Astro 20 gives you user friendly digital control and IR utilisation, but with old school balls-to-the-wall Soldano tube growl.
